Understanding Vitamin E: The Basics
Vitamin E is a fat-soluble vitamin and a powerful antioxidant that protects the body's cells from oxidative damage caused by free radicals. It is vital for a healthy immune system, cellular communication, and red blood cell formation. Most people can meet their daily vitamin E requirements, which are 15 mg (22.4 IU) for adults, through a balanced diet rich in nuts, seeds, vegetable oils, and green leafy vegetables. However, the rising popularity of supplements has led many to question the safety and consequences of consistent, high-dose intake.
The Risks of Daily High-Dose Vitamin E
While moderate intake from food is safe, daily supplementation with high doses of vitamin E can lead to several health risks, a condition known as vitamin E toxicity or hypervitaminosis E.
Increased Bleeding Risk
Perhaps the most significant and well-documented risk is its anticoagulant effect. Vitamin E can thin the blood and inhibit blood clotting, especially at doses exceeding 400 IU per day. This is particularly dangerous for individuals on blood-thinning medications like warfarin or aspirin, or those with existing bleeding disorders. In severe cases, this can lead to hemorrhagic stroke, a type of stroke caused by bleeding in the brain.
Other Adverse Effects
Beyond the risk of bleeding, excessive daily vitamin E can trigger a range of other side effects, including:
- Nausea and gastrointestinal distress
- Fatigue and muscle weakness
- Headaches and blurred vision
- Diarrhea
Potential Increase in Cancer Risk
Some studies have indicated a potential link between high-dose vitamin E supplementation and increased cancer risk. A notable study, the Selenium and Vitamin E Cancer Prevention Trial (SELECT), observed an increased risk of prostate cancer in men who took 400 IU of synthetic vitamin E daily over several years. This finding raises serious concerns about indiscriminate supplementation.
Benefits Versus Risks: Is Daily Supplementation Worth It?
For most people, the health benefits of daily vitamin E supplementation are minimal and do not outweigh the potential risks. However, supplementation may be recommended by a healthcare professional for specific conditions or deficiencies. The key is to distinguish between getting enough vitamin E from food versus relying on high-dose pills.
Comparative Table: Food vs. Supplements
| Feature | Vitamin E from Food | Vitamin E from Supplements |
|---|---|---|
| Source | Naturally occurring in foods (e.g., nuts, seeds, oils) | Concentrated, often synthetic forms (dl-alpha-tocopherol) |
| Absorption | Generally better absorbed by the body | Absorption can vary and may be less efficient than natural forms |
| Risks | Extremely low risk of toxicity | Significant risks of toxicity and bleeding at high doses |
| Interactions | No significant drug interactions | Can interact with blood thinners and other medications |
| Daily Need | Easily met through a varied diet | Often exceeds daily requirement, leading to excess storage |
Natural Sources of Vitamin E
Instead of taking tablets, most individuals should focus on obtaining vitamin E from natural food sources. These include:
- Vegetable Oils: Sunflower, safflower, and wheat germ oil are excellent sources.
- Nuts and Seeds: Almonds, sunflower seeds, and hazelnuts are rich in vitamin E.
- Green Leafy Vegetables: Spinach and broccoli contain good amounts of this vitamin.
- Fortified Foods: Many cereals and fruit juices are fortified with vitamin E.
Who Might Need a Supplement?
Vitamin E deficiency is rare but can occur in individuals with certain medical conditions that affect fat absorption, such as Crohn's disease, cystic fibrosis, or liver disease. In these cases, a doctor may recommend monitored supplementation. It is critical to consult a healthcare provider before beginning any daily supplement regimen to assess your specific needs and risks.
The Tolerable Upper Intake Level (UL)
The National Institutes of Health has set a Tolerable Upper Intake Level (UL) for supplemental vitamin E at 1,000 mg (1,500 IU for natural, 1,100 IU for synthetic) daily for adults. Consuming doses below this level is generally considered safe for most, but potential harms have been observed at doses much lower than the UL. This highlights the importance of caution and expert consultation before daily intake.
Conclusion
While some may take vitamin E tablets daily for perceived health benefits like antioxidant protection or immune support, for the majority of the population, daily supplementation is unnecessary and poses significant health risks. The potential for vitamin E toxicity, particularly the increased risk of severe bleeding and potential links to certain cancers, far outweighs the minimal benefits for those without a diagnosed deficiency. A diet rich in natural sources is the safest and most effective way to maintain adequate vitamin E levels.
